Despite valuation metrics suggesting undervaluation, market participants remain skeptical. The Zacks Rank system, which incorporates analyst estimate revisions, currently lists LULU at #5 (Strong Sell), . These divergent views reflect a tug-of-war between fundamental strengths—such as consistent free cash flow and brand equity—and near-term operational challenges. Investors will likely await clarity on the company’s ability to navigate macroeconomic risks and sustain its market leadership.
